SWSA OPEN RESULTS AT BIRDS / CARDIFF FORESHORE & PENARTH, 14th DECEMBER 2025

A cracking turn-out today of 81 (anglers, (29 seniors & 2 juniors) with a first  for SWSA with the event being fished over 3 venues. The weather remained pretty good throughout the event with a moderate south westerly wind. Fishing was tough, and the anglers had to work hard for the fish; most of which were caught on the flood & top water, with conger eels & thornback rays being the main catch. Penarth section of the venue marginally out fished Birds/Cardiff Foreshore.

​

Thirty anglers caught fish with 6 different species being caught i.e., Conger/Silver eels, thornback rays, pouting, whiting & 5 bearded rockling totalling 42.8 kgs.

First Place was  Dai Llewellyn with 5.65kg including a conger eel of 4.135kg. Dai also won the Bob Radman Trophy which was presented by Bob (below left), and the heaviest conger pool.

​

2nd place went to Robbie Wall with a weight of 5.49kg which included a fine 4.99kg thornback ray.

Third place with 3.4kg - Alan Wayne Price

Fourth place with 3.355kg - Drew  Abraham

Fifth place with 2.75kg - Kaden Copp

Heaviest Whiting Pool was won by Chris Mather with a whiting of 0.33kg winning him £158 in pool money

First place in the junior category was won by Dan Winter with 0.73kg

Garry Evans Seamasters Leg - Cardiff SAC Open
30th November Cardiff Foreshore & Penarth

With restrictions on the Cardiff Foreshore access, for the first time, Cardiff fished their annual open competition over two venues, Cardiff & Penarth. There was a good attendance of 92 seniors & 2 juniors. 32 anglers caught fish totalling 61kgs.

 

Six different species in all were caught which included conger eels, dog fish, thornback ray, pouting, silver eel & whiting. Most of the top places were taken from anglers fishing Penarth beach.

All top Three prizes were donated by ELEUSIS ENGINEERING.

In first place was Penarth member Lee Williams with 5.005kgs consisting of 2 conger eels. Lee won £350 plus the heaviest conger eel pool of £150
